Benefits
Treatment of Heartburn / Treatment of Gastroesophageal reflux disease (Acid reflux) / Treatment of Peptic ulcer diseaseTreatment of Heartburn / Treatment of Gastroesophageal reflux disease (Acid reflux) / Treatment of Peptic ulcer disease
In Treatment of Heartburn Heartburn and acid reflux happens when a muscle above your stomach relaxes too much and allows stomach contents and acid to come back up into your esophagus and mouth. Pantosec IV Injection belongs to a group of medicines called proton pump inhibitors. It reduces the amount of acid your stomach makes and relieves the pain associated with heartburn and acid reflux. You can increase the efficiency of the medicine by making certain lifestyle changes. These include avoiding foods that trigger the symptoms, eating smaller more frequent meals, losing weight if you are overweight. In Treatment of Gastroesophageal reflux disease (Acid reflux) GERD is a chronic (long-term) condition that is like having heartburn consistently rather than just occasionally. It happens because a muscle above your stomach relaxes too much and allows stomach contents to come back up into your esophagus and mouth. Pantosec IV Injection belongs to a group of medicines called proton pump inhibitors. It reduces the amount of acid your stomach makes and relieves the pain associated with heartburn and acid reflux. You should take it exactly as it is prescribed for it to be effective. Some simple lifestyle changes can help reduce the symptoms of GERD. Think about what foods trigger heartburn and try to avoid them; eat smaller more frequent meals; try to lose weight if you are overweight and try to find ways to relax. Do not eat within 3-4 hours of going to bed. In Treatment of Peptic ulcer disease Pantosec IV Injection belongs to a group of medicines called proton pump inhibitors. It reduces the amount of acid your stomach makes which prevents further damage to the ulcer as it heals naturally. You may be given other medicines along with this medicine depending on what caused the ulcer. Frequently asked questions
Can I use Pantosec IV Injection 1s long-term?
Pantosec IV Injection 1s is typically for short-term use, but may be prescribed long-term for certain conditions. Discuss with your doctor.
Is one dose of Pantosec IV Injection 1s enough?
A single dose may not suffice. Regular use for up to 2 weeks is often needed. Consult your doctor if symptoms persist.
What is the purpose of Pantosec IV Injection 1s?
Pantosec IV Injection 1s treats peptic ulcer disease, reflux esophagitis, GERD, and Zollinger Ellison syndrome by reducing stomach acid production.
Does Pantosec IV Injection 1s lead to weight gain?
Long-term use of Pantosec IV Injection 1s may cause weight gain due to symptom relief. Consult your doctor for concerns.
Can I combine antacids with Pantosec IV Injection 1s?
Yes, take antacids 2 hours before or after Pantosec IV Injection 1s.
How quickly does Pantosec IV Injection 1s take effect?
You may feel better in 2 to 3 days, but it can take up to 4 weeks for full effect.
Are painkillers safe to use with Pantosec IV Injection 1s?
Yes, Pantosec IV Injection 1s protects against acidity and ulcers caused by painkillers. Take Pantosec IV Injection 1s 1 hour before meals.
Is alcohol consumption safe with Pantosec IV Injection 1s?
No, avoid alcohol as it can increase acid production and worsen symptoms.
What dietary changes should I make while taking Pantosec IV Injection 1s?
Pantosec IV Injection 1s should be taken 1 hour before meals. Avoid spicy, fatty foods, caffeinated drinks, and alcohol.
What are the potential long-term side effects of Pantosec IV Injection 1s?
Long-term use (over 3 months) may cause low magnesium levels, fatigue, confusion, muscle twitches, and increased risk of fractures, infections, and vitamin B12 deficiency.
